Moreover, Congress-typically not a reliable defender of rights-has contributed meaningfully to our freedom to speak without fear of legal retaliation. The Court's defense of free speech is not perfect-students and public employees have seen some narrowing of rights-but it is unprecedented in American history, and in sharp contrast to the Court's halfhearted defense of Fourth, Fifth, and Sixth Amendment rights. Instead, it has adhered to a select, narrowly defined list of historical exceptions, rejecting efforts to create a general "balancing test" that would determine whether speech is protected by an ad hoc weighing of its value and harm. The Court has protected scatological and humiliating ridicule of public figures and overturned laws purporting to bar "disparaging" or "immoral or scandalous" trademarks, firmly establishing that offensive speech is free speech.Ĭrucially, the Court has repeatedly rebuked demands that it create new First Amendment exceptions based on the tastes of the moment. Years later, in upholding the right of Westboro Baptist Church to picket the funerals of servicemen with vile homophobic insults, the Court aggrieved both the left and the right, permitting violation of norms of veneration of the military and against hate speech. In overturning flag burning laws, the Court protected (literally) incendiary speech that remains intolerable to many Americans. The Court's staunch defense of the First Amendment is remarkable because it has transcended political partisanship and upheld speech that offends everyone, including the powerful. This is a golden age for free speech in America.įor more than a generation, the United States Supreme Court has reliably protected unpopular speech from government sanction. The first six Tomb Raider games were developed by Core Design, a British video game development company owned by Eidos Interactive. Titles The entrance of 55 Ashbourne Road in Derby where Core Design used to develop Tomb Raider.įurther information: List of Tomb Raider media The series has generally been met with critical acclaim, and Lara Croft has become one of the most recognisable video game protagonists, winning accolades and earning places on the Walk of Game and Guinness World Records. while the entire franchise generated close to $1.2 billion in revenue by 2002. Tomb Raider games have sold over 95 million copies worldwide by 2022. Other developers have contributed to spin-off titles and ports of mainline entries. This prompted Eidos to switch development duties to Crystal Dynamics, which has been the series' primary developer since. The sixth game, The Angel of Darkness, faced difficulties during development and was considered a failure at release. Its critical and commercial success prompted Core Design to develop a new game annually for the next four years, which put a strain on staff. ĭevelopment of the original Tomb Raider game began in 1994 it was released two years later. It was also reported this would involve a tie-in video game and movie in an interconnected universe, likened to the Marvel Cinematic Universe. On January 27, 2023, The Hollywood Reporter reported that Phoebe Waller-Bridge was set to write a TV show adaptation of the video game franchise for Amazon. Additional media has been developed for the franchise in the form of film adaptations, comics and novels. Gameplay generally focuses on exploration of environments, solving puzzles, navigating hostile environments filled with traps, and fighting enemies. Formerly owned by Eidos Interactive, then by Square Enix Europe after Square Enix's acquisition of Eidos in 2009, the franchise focuses on the fictional British archaeologist Lara Croft, who travels around the world searching for lost artefacts and infiltrating dangerous tombs and ruins. Tomb Raider, also known as Lara Croft: Tomb Raider from 2001 to 2008, is a media franchise that originated with an action-adventure video game series created by British gaming company Core Design. If an app doesn’t support casting, you can still show it on the big screen by mirroring it - provided your device is compatible and it’s connected to the same network as your Roku. You will see content exactly as it is shown on your mobile device. Screen mirroring is a little different because it literally mirrors your whole screen to your TV. Once you cast to your TV, it will display the app only, not your device’s whole screen. (If you want to add channels like the YouTube TV app and it’s not available in your region, our best VPN for Roku guide can help.) You need to connect them both to the same network, too (that includes Roku with Ethernet). You’ll need to add the channel to your Roku, as well as install it on your mobile device. If you see this icon within an app, it supports casting. Please note that current Roku devices need to be running Roku OS 7.7 or later, and iOS mobile devices need to be running iOS 12.3 or later to support screen mirroring to cast to Roku TV or other Roku devices. To cast from a supported app, the app needs to be installed on both the Roku and the device you want to cast from.Your Roku and the device you want to cast or mirror from need to be connected to the same network.Casting will only display the “casted” app, whereas screen mirroring will display your device’s whole screen.How you do that can vary with each device, but our guide will show you how to cast to Roku from iOS, Android and Windows 10. You can also cast or mirror your screen straight to Roku, which is great if you want to quickly pop something up on the big screen. Rokus are handy all-in-one streaming boxes, but they can do more than just stream content from channels and services.
